腾讯云服务器上的Gitblit,高效代码管理与协作的新选择
腾讯云服务器上的Gitblit为高效代码管理与协作提供了新选择,作为基于Git的代码管理工具,Gitblit支持代码托管、版本控制、分支管理等功能,助力团队协作开发,其部署在腾讯云服务器上,结合云服务的高可用性和安全性,为开发者提供稳定可靠的代码管理环境,适用于企业级开发需求。
在数字化转型的浪潮中,企业对高效代码管理和协作工具的需求日益增长,腾讯云服务器作为国内领先的云计算平台,为开发者提供了强大的基础设施支持,而Gitblit,作为一款功能强大的Git仓库管理工具,与腾讯云服务器的结合,为开发者和企业带来了全新的代码管理体验,本文将深入探讨腾讯云服务器上的Gitblit如何助力高效开发,以及它在实际应用中的优势和前景。
Gitblit:代码管理的全能工具
Gitblit是一款开源的Git仓库管理工具,它不仅支持代码托管,还提供了代码审查、团队协作、权限管理等功能,Gitblit的设计理念是“简单而强大”,它通过Web界面和API接口,让用户能够轻松管理Git仓库,无论是个人开发者还是企业团队,Gitblit都能满足他们的需求。
1 Gitblit的核心功能
- 代码托管:Gitblit支持多种版本控制系统,包括Git、Subversion等,能够满足不同开发场景的需求。
- 代码审查:内置的代码审查功能,让团队成员可以方便地对代码进行评审,确保代码质量。
- 权限管理:Gitblit提供了细粒度的权限控制,管理员可以根据项目需求设置不同的访问权限。
- 统计分析:通过内置的统计功能,开发者可以了解代码的提交历史、活跃度等信息,为项目管理提供数据支持。
2 Gitblit的优势
- 开源免费:Gitblit是开源软件,用户可以免费使用,同时可以根据需求进行定制开发。
- 易于部署:Gitblit的安装和配置相对简单,支持多种部署方式,包括本地部署和云服务器部署。
- 社区支持:Gitblit拥有活跃的开源社区,用户可以获取丰富的资源和帮助。
腾讯云服务器:为Gitblit提供强大支持
腾讯云服务器(CVM)作为国内领先的云服务器产品,以其高性能、高可用性和高安全性著称,将Gitblit部署在腾讯云服务器上,能够充分发挥其优势,为开发者和企业提供稳定、高效的代码管理服务。
1 腾讯云服务器的优势
- 高性能:腾讯云服务器采用最新的硬件技术,提供强大的计算能力和存储性能,确保Gitblit的稳定运行。
- 高可用性:腾讯云服务器支持多可用区部署,确保服务的高可用性和容灾能力。
- 高安全性:腾讯云服务器提供多层次的安全防护,包括防火墙、入侵检测、数据加密等,保障代码的安全性。
2 在腾讯云服务器上部署Gitblit的优势
- 快速部署:腾讯云提供了丰富的镜像和模板,用户可以快速完成Gitblit的部署。
- 弹性扩展:根据项目需求,用户可以随时调整服务器的配置,实现资源的弹性扩展。
- 成本优化:腾讯云服务器采用按需付费的模式,用户可以根据实际使用情况优化成本。
Gitblit在腾讯云服务器上的应用场景
Gitblit与腾讯云服务器的结合,为开发者和企业提供了丰富的应用场景,无论是个人项目还是企业级开发,Gitblit都能发挥重要作用。
1 企业级开发
在企业级开发中,代码管理和协作是关键,Gitblit提供了强大的权限管理和代码审查功能,能够满足企业的安全性和协作需求,腾讯云服务器的高可用性和高安全性,为企业的代码管理提供了可靠保障。
2 开源项目
对于开源项目,Gitblit的开源特性和社区支持非常契合,开发者可以轻松托管开源项目,并通过Gitblit的Web界面进行协作和管理,腾讯云服务器的高性能和弹性扩展,能够支持开源项目的快速发展。
3 教育科研
在教育和科研领域,Gitblit可以作为教学和科研的工具,帮助学生和研究人员进行代码管理和协作,腾讯云服务器的稳定性和安全性,为教育和科研提供了可靠的支持。
在腾讯云服务器上配置Gitblit的步骤
在腾讯云服务器上配置Gitblit,可以按照以下步骤进行:
1 准备工作
- 注册腾讯云账号:如果还没有腾讯云账号,需要先注册并完成实名认证。
- 选择合适的云服务器配置:根据项目需求选择合适的云服务器配置,包括CPU、内存、存储等。
2 部署Gitblit
- 登录云服务器:通过SSH或控制台登录到云服务器。
- 安装Java环境:Gitblit需要Java环境,安装JDK并配置环境变量。
- 下载并安装Gitblit:从Gitblit的官方网站下载最新版本,并按照说明进行安装。
- 配置Gitblit:根据需求配置Gitblit的参数,包括数据库、存储路径等。
3 启动和访问Gitblit
- 启动Gitblit服务:运行Gitblit的启动脚本,启动服务。
- 访问Gitblit:通过浏览器访问Gitblit的Web界面,进行进一步的配置和管理。
Gitblit与腾讯云服务器的协同发展
随着云计算和开源技术的不断发展,Gitblit与腾讯云服务器的结合将更加紧密,腾讯云服务器的不断优化和Gitblit的持续更新,将为开发者和企业提供更强大的代码管理能力,我们可以期待Gitblit在腾讯云服务器上的更多创新应用,为代码管理和协作带来更多的可能性。
腾讯云服务器上的Gitblit,为开发者和企业提供了高效、稳定、安全的代码管理解决方案,通过Gitblit的功能和腾讯云服务器的优势,用户可以轻松实现代码托管、协作和管理,无论是个人开发者还是企业团队,都可以从中受益,随着技术的不断进步,Gitblit与腾讯云服务器的结合将为代码管理领域带来更多的创新和突破。